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 Tablets (12.5mg-50mg-200mg) – Complete Product Description

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 is a prescription medication used for the treatment of Parkinson’s disease in patients experiencing motor fluctuations and “wearing-off” symptoms associated with Levodopa therapy. Each tablet contains Carbidopa 12.5mg, Levodopa 50mg, and Entacapone 200mg, working together to improve dopamine availability and provide more consistent symptom control.

This three-drug combination helps increase the effectiveness and duration of Levodopa therapy. By combining Carbidopa, Levodopa, and Entacapone into a single tablet, the medication offers a convenient treatment option for individuals requiring optimized Parkinson’s disease management.

How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 Works

Levodopa is converted into dopamine in the brain, helping restore dopamine levels that are reduced in Parkinson’s disease. Increased dopamine activity helps improve movement control and reduce symptoms such as tremors, stiffness, and slow movement.

Carbidopa prevents the premature breakdown of Levodopa before it reaches the brain, allowing more medication to become available where it is needed while reducing certain side effects.

Entacapone is a COMT (Catechol-O-Methyltransferase) inhibitor that slows the breakdown of Levodopa in the body. This action prolongs the therapeutic effects of Levodopa and helps provide more stable symptom management throughout the day.

Dosage and Administration

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 should be taken exactly as prescribed by a healthcare professional. Dosage schedules are individualized based on disease severity, previous Parkinson’s treatment, and patient response.

The tablet should be swallowed whole with water and may be taken with or without food as directed by your physician. Consistent dosing is important for maintaining stable symptom control.

Do not stop taking the medication suddenly without consulting your healthcare provider, as abrupt discontinuation may result in serious complications.

Possible Side Effects

Like all medications,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 may cause side effects, although not everyone experiences them.

  • Nausea
  • Dizziness
  • Drowsiness
  • Headache
  • Diarrhea
  • Dry mouth
  • Sleep disturbances
  • Low blood pressure when standing
  • Involuntary movements (dyskinesia)
  • Brownish-orange discoloration of urine

Seek immediate medical attention if severe allergic reactions, hallucinations, chest pain, confusion, severe diarrhea, or unusual behavioral changes occur.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 used for?

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 is used to manage Parkinson’s disease symptoms and reduce motor fluctuations or “wearing-off” episodes associated with Levodopa treatment.

2. Why is Entacapone included in this medication?

Entacapone helps extend the effectiveness of Levodopa by slowing its breakdown in the body, allowing symptom relief to last longer.

3. What do the strengths 12.5mg-50mg-200mg represent?

Each tablet contains Carbidopa 12.5mg, Levodopa 50mg, and Entacapone 200mg, which work together to improve dopamine availability and symptom control.

4. Can Carbidopa-Levodopa-Entacapone 50 cure Parkinson’s disease?

No. This medication does not cure Parkinson’s disease but helps manage symptoms, improve mobility, and enhance quality of life.

5. Is urine discoloration normal while taking this medicine?

Yes. Entacapone may cause harmless brownish-orange discoloration of urine, sweat, or saliva. This is a known and generally harmless effect.
